Wednesday, September 19, 2007

TMBG have two amazing new videos

The latest video from They Might Be Giants features an evil moon, newspapers everywhere, evil Humvees and confusing road signs. It is just like life in Northern Virginia (except the evil moon part). Because you know, the Shadow Government lives across the Potomac from the ostensible Real Government.

The Shadow Government

And tackling similar themes, but in completely different imagery is the video for I'm Impressed. It is amazingly emotionally affective and even shocking. I'd hazard the dual meaning for the term "impressed" has to be intentional as our dear Johns are oh so clever and literate. Take the time, and watch and rewatch: I'm Impressed

No comments: